WebMar 23, 2024 · Analysis of the Capital to Provide Benefits. Initial £6,000 of the capital is not considered and has no benefit. The limit for the people living in a care home is £10,000, and no benefits are provided if the capital is over £16,000. Moreover, a tariff income of £1 is assumed for each £250 capital between the upper and lower limits. Related: ‘How much will I need ... WebFor tax credits, the savings limit of £16,000 doesn’t exist. Instead, your tax credits are affected by how much income (usually interest) you receive from those savings. WebJan 3, 2024 · We use the following earnings limits to reduce your benefits: If you are under full retirement age for the entire year, we deduct $1 from your benefit payments for every $2 you earn above the annual limit. For 2024 that limit is $21,240. WebSometimes we “deem” a portion of the resources of a spouse, parent, parent’s spouse, sponsor of a noncitizen, or sponsor’s spouse as belonging to the person who applies for SSI. We call this process the deeming of resources. If a child under age 18 lives with one parent, $2,000 of the parent's total countable resources does not count.
